Air Resource Warmth Pumps vs. Geothermal Heat Pumps



When taking into consideration Air Source Heat Pumps vs. Geothermal Heat Pumps for your home, there are essential distinctions to keep in mind.

Air Source Warmth Pumps remove warm from the outdoors air and are much more typical because of reduced setup expenses. They work well in moderate climates yet may be less effective in severe cold.

Geothermal Heat Pumps, on the other hand, utilize warmth from the ground, supplying constant home heating and cooling despite outside temperature levels. While they have actually greater ahead of time expenses, they're much more energy-efficient in the long run and have a longer life-span.

Air Resource Warmth Pumps are simpler to install and preserve compared to Geothermal Heat Pumps, which need even more intricate underground installments. However, Geothermal Warm Pumps offer higher power savings over time, making them a more eco-friendly option.



Consider your climate, budget, and lasting goals when choosing in between these 2 kinds of heatpump for your home.

Price Analysis: Setup and Procedure Expenditures



Taking into consideration the expenses related to both installment and operation is essential when comparing Air Resource Warm Pumps and Geothermal Warmth Pumps. Air Resource Warmth Pumps are typically more economical to install in advance compared to Geothermal Warmth Pumps. The setup of a Geothermal Heat Pump includes extra complicated underground work, making it a costlier alternative initially. However, Geothermal Heat Pumps are understood for their higher performance, which can result in reduced operational expenses in time.

When it pertains to operational costs, Geothermal Warmth Pumps tend to be much more affordable in the long run as a result of their higher performance and reduced power usage. They can give considerable cost savings on cooling and heating expenses, offsetting the greater installation expenses.

Air Resource Heat Pumps, while having reduced ahead of time costs, may cause somewhat greater operational costs since they aren't as efficient as their geothermal counterparts.

Eventually, the best option for your home depends on your spending plan, long-term energy goals, and particular heating and cooling requirements. Consider both the installment and operation expenses very carefully before deciding.
